Flip, Sip or Strip is a coin flipping, clothes stripping, beer drinking hootenanny of a game. Take note that the stripping aspect of the game is one that not everyone may feel comfortable with.
Sip Score: *** (Medium-Sipping game)
Game Description: Flip, Sip or Strip is a drinking game in which the primary modes of play involve flipping a coin, sipping beer or removing clothes, the latter two being penalties. As this game is one that potentially involves nudity, it is really important for all players (especially if this is played with guys and gals together) that they trust each other and feel comfortable. If any player feels uncomfortable at any time, it’s important they can stop whenever they want.
Number of Players: Minimum of three.
You Will Need: A coin, some buddies and the most important ingredient: BOOZE! This game works best with players who know each other well and trust each other. It’s best to play this at home; not many bartenders will appreciate the clothes-removing aspect, so be warned!
How to Play: Have your buddies sit together with all your drinks at the ready. Get your coins ready and decide the order of players. The first player flips a coin in the air and has to guess the flip mid-air and let it land on their hand. The result each coin flip will determine the course of action for the next move in the game…
Rules of the Game:
N.B. Make sure that ALL players agree with and are comfortable with any rules of the game with pertain to stripping or removing clothes. Don’t take advantage of drunken players by making them remove clothing if they aren’t happy to do so or able to give genuine consent. Play sensibly, responsibly and considerately.
NO COINS ARE PERMITTED BE CAUGHT WHILE STILL IN THE AIR: The coins MUST land on the hand of the player who flipped the coin. If a player mistakenly catches a coin in the air, they have to TAKE A DRINK as a penalty.
CORRECTLY GUESSING THE FLIP: A player correctly guessing the flip can decide to flip the coin a second time, or pass to the player on their right hand side.
INCORRECTLY GUESSING THE FLIP: Getting the coin toss wrong means…SIPPING OR STRIPPING! Either take a drink, or take off an item of clothing…
IF A PLAYER GETS THREE SUCCESSIVE CORRECT GUESSES AT THE COIN FLIP: This player can choose to pass the coin onto the next player to their right OR can choose to put on an item of clothing they lost in previous incorrect coin flips.
ALL CLOTHING IS UP FOR GRABS: Any item can be removed, unless players specify at the beginning of the game that certain items of clothing are off-limits. This is a rule which all players have to agree upon before playing. This rule can either be removed or modified, as per the preferences of all players.
You Lose: If you end up drunk and or naked by the game’s end, which means you have lost the most coin flips.
